import { once } from 'node:events';
import readline from 'node:readline';
import { killProcessTree, spawnCli } from '@main/utils/childProcess';
interface JsonRpcLogger {
warn: (message: string, meta?: Record<string, unknown>) => void;
}
interface JsonRpcErrorPayload {
code?: number;
message?: string;
data?: unknown;
}
interface JsonRpcResponse<T> {
id?: number;
result?: T;
error?: JsonRpcErrorPayload;
}
interface JsonRpcNotificationMessage {
method?: string;
params?: unknown;
}
export interface JsonRpcSession {
request<TResult>(method: string, params?: unknown, timeoutMs?: number): Promise<TResult>;
notify(method: string, params?: unknown): Promise<void>;
onNotification(listener: (method: string, params: unknown) => void): () => void;
close(): Promise<void>;
}
function withTimeout<T>(promise: Promise<T>, timeoutMs: number, label: string): Promise<T> {
let timeoutId: ReturnType<typeof setTimeout> | null = null;
const timeoutPromise = new Promise<T>((_resolve, reject) => {
timeoutId = setTimeout(
() => reject(new Error(`${label} timed out after ${timeoutMs}ms`)),
timeoutMs
);
});
return Promise.race([promise, timeoutPromise]).finally(() => {
if (timeoutId) {
clearTimeout(timeoutId);
}
}) as Promise<T>;
}
const DEFAULT_REQUEST_TIMEOUT_MS = 3_000;
const DEFAULT_TOTAL_TIMEOUT_MS = 8_000;
export class JsonRpcRequestError extends Error {
readonly code: number | null;
readonly data: unknown;
readonly details: unknown;
readonly method: string;
constructor(method: string, payload: JsonRpcErrorPayload) {
super(payload.message ?? 'Unknown JSON-RPC error');
this.name = 'JsonRpcRequestError';
this.method = method;
this.code = typeof payload.code === 'number' ? payload.code : null;
this.data = payload.data;
this.details = payload.data;
}
}
export class JsonRpcStdioClient {
constructor(private readonly logger: JsonRpcLogger) {}
async withSession<T>(
options: {
binaryPath: string;
args: string[];
env?: NodeJS.ProcessEnv;
requestTimeoutMs?: number;
totalTimeoutMs?: number;
label: string;
},
handler: (session: JsonRpcSession) => Promise<T>
): Promise<T> {
const session = await this.openSession(options);
const totalTimeoutMs = options.totalTimeoutMs ?? DEFAULT_TOTAL_TIMEOUT_MS;
try {
return await withTimeout(handler(session), totalTimeoutMs, options.label);
} finally {
await session.close();
}
}
async openSession(options: {
binaryPath: string;
args: string[];
env?: NodeJS.ProcessEnv;
requestTimeoutMs?: number;
}): Promise<JsonRpcSession> {
const requestTimeoutMs = options.requestTimeoutMs ?? DEFAULT_REQUEST_TIMEOUT_MS;
const child = spawnCli(options.binaryPath, options.args, {
env: options.env,
stdio: ['pipe', 'pipe', 'pipe'],
windowsHide: true,
});
const lineReader = readline.createInterface({ input: child.stdout! });
child.stderr?.on('data', () => {
// Keep stderr drained so warnings never block the pipe.
});
const pending = new Map<
number,
{
method: string;
resolve: (value: unknown) => void;
reject: (error: Error) => void;
timeoutId: ReturnType<typeof setTimeout>;
}
>();
const notificationListeners = new Set<(method: string, params: unknown) => void>();
let nextRequestId = 1;
let closed = false;
const rejectAll = (error: Error): void => {
for (const [id, entry] of pending) {
clearTimeout(entry.timeoutId);
entry.reject(error);
pending.delete(id);
}
};
const handleNotification = (message: JsonRpcNotificationMessage): void => {
if (typeof message.method !== 'string' || message.method.length === 0) {
return;
}
for (const listener of notificationListeners) {
try {
listener(message.method, message.params);
} catch (error) {
this.logger.warn('json-rpc notification listener failed', {
error: error instanceof Error ? error.message : String(error),
method: message.method,
});
}
}
};
lineReader.on('line', (line) => {
let message: JsonRpcResponse<unknown> & JsonRpcNotificationMessage;
try {
message = JSON.parse(line) as JsonRpcResponse<unknown> & JsonRpcNotificationMessage;
} catch (error) {
this.logger.warn('json-rpc stdio emitted non-json line', {
error: error instanceof Error ? error.message : String(error),
});
return;
}
if (typeof message.id === 'number') {
const entry = pending.get(message.id);
if (!entry) {
return;
}
clearTimeout(entry.timeoutId);
pending.delete(message.id);
if (message.error) {
entry.reject(new JsonRpcRequestError(entry.method, message.error));
return;
}
entry.resolve(message.result);
return;
}
handleNotification(message);
});
child.once('error', (error) => {
rejectAll(error instanceof Error ? error : new Error(String(error)));
});
child.once('exit', (code, signal) => {
if (pending.size === 0) {
return;
}
rejectAll(
new Error(
`JSON-RPC process exited unexpectedly (code=${code ?? 'null'} signal=${signal ?? 'null'})`
)
);
});
const close = async (): Promise<void> => {
if (closed) {
return;
}
closed = true;
rejectAll(new Error('JSON-RPC session closed'));
notificationListeners.clear();
lineReader.close();
if (child.stdin && !child.stdin.destroyed && !child.stdin.writableEnded) {
await new Promise<void>((resolve) => {
try {
child.stdin!.end(() => resolve());
} catch {
resolve();
}
});
}
killProcessTree(child);
try {
await once(child, 'close');
} catch {
this.logger.warn('json-rpc close wait failed');
}
};
return {
request: <TResult>(
method: string,
params?: unknown,
timeoutMs = requestTimeoutMs
): Promise<TResult> =>
new Promise<TResult>((resolve, reject) => {
if (!child.stdin || child.stdin.destroyed || child.stdin.writableEnded) {
reject(new Error('JSON-RPC stdin is not available'));
return;
}
const id = nextRequestId++;
const timeoutId = setTimeout(() => {
pending.delete(id);
reject(new Error(`JSON-RPC request timed out: ${method}`));
}, timeoutMs);
pending.set(id, {
method,
resolve: resolve as (value: unknown) => void,
reject,
timeoutId,
});
child.stdin.write(
`${JSON.stringify({ jsonrpc: '2.0', id, method, params })}\n`,
(error) => {
if (!error) {
return;
}
clearTimeout(timeoutId);
pending.delete(id);
reject(error instanceof Error ? error : new Error(String(error)));
}
);
}),
notify: async (method: string, params?: unknown): Promise<void> => {
if (!child.stdin || child.stdin.destroyed || child.stdin.writableEnded) {
throw new Error('JSON-RPC stdin is not available');
}
await new Promise<void>((resolve, reject) => {
child.stdin!.write(`${JSON.stringify({ jsonrpc: '2.0', method, params })}\n`, (error) => {
if (error) {
reject(error instanceof Error ? error : new Error(String(error)));
return;
}
resolve();
});
});
},
onNotification: (listener) => {
notificationListeners.add(listener);
return (): void => {
notificationListeners.delete(listener);
};
},
close,
};
}
}
